The category changed because the work changed

Older versions of the market were built around websites and marketing services. That mattered, but it only solved the first problem, getting drivers to the door. The operational problem stayed in place, which is why modern shop platforms now have to handle estimating, inspections, invoicing, and reporting inside one system.

The history of the space shows that shift clearly. Autoshop Solutions traces its origin to 1998, “when the Internet was still new and growing,” which signals that shop-focused digital marketing was already becoming its own category then. A later profile places the company's founding at 2005, and another industry profile says it made the Inc. 5000 for three consecutive years, 2013, 2014, and 2015, while AutoInc. recognized it for seven years in a row for top websites. That arc says a lot about where the market went.

Practical rule: If a vendor only helps a shop get found online, that vendor is solving demand. If it helps the team process the car from start to finish, that is an auto shop solution.

Start with the shop management backbone

Shop management software is the central nervous system. It holds the customer record, the vehicle history, the work order, the schedule, and the status of every active job. Without it, the front counter lives in email threads and sticky notes, which is a bad place to run a business.

A simple example is a returning customer who shows up for a brake concern. The advisor should pull the record, see prior work, assign the job, and route it without rebuilding the file from scratch. That's the difference between a real operating system and a glorified spreadsheet.

Add the tools that move money, not just data

Point-of-sale handles invoicing and checkout. Digital vehicle inspections turn a vague complaint into photos, notes, and clear approval requests. Parts procurement checks inventory and supplier options before the advisor promises a repair. Diagnostics and repair data give technicians the procedure and application match they need instead of forcing a trip to the dealer for answers.

A shop owner should be able to ask one blunt question about each module. Does this tool reduce friction at the exact moment the car is waiting? If the answer is no, the feature is probably cosmetic.

Don't forget the customer-facing layer

The sixth module is the one many owners underestimate, customer relationship management. It keeps service history, communication, and follow-up organized so the shop doesn't rely on memory or a front-desk hero.

A customer can approve a brake job from a phone after seeing annotated photos. Parts can be ordered without the advisor calling three suppliers. The invoice can be paid online instead of standing around the counter. That kind of flow is what makes the system useful.

Features that protect labor and prevent leaks

The deepest operational leak is hidden in dealer referrals. The Auto Care Association says limited vehicle data access is the top issue facing the repair industry, and it cites Babcox Media findings that shops spend an average of 2 to 4 labor hours per vehicle before referring it out. That time is often unrecovered. A decent repair-data module should help a shop spot that loss sooner and cut the time spent guessing.

That is where OEM-level data coverage matters. Solera's Autodata reports support for 43,500 vehicle models, 170+ manufacturers, and 600,000 step-by-step procedures, with 40,000 vehicle updates added in the last 12 months. For a working shop, that means fewer wrong procedures and a better shot at the first fix.

Good buying rule: If a feature does not improve an approval, protect labor, speed payment, or reduce admin work, it belongs in the nice-to-have pile.

Building a Realistic ROI Picture for Your Shop

The owner who buys software based on the sticker price ends up paying twice, once to buy it and again to patch the workflow around it. The better way is to price the time saved, the work recovered, and the labor protected against dealer referrals. That's the financial story an accountant can work with.

A bar chart illustrating ROI benefits like saved hours, increased approval rates, and improved parts ordering accuracy.

Use capacity, not guesswork, as the baseline

PartsTech's 2025 Auto Repair Shop Report puts the average daily car count at 2.2 vehicles per bay. That benchmark matters because every small improvement in approvals, checkout speed, or recovered labor hits a finite number of bays, not an infinite sales pipe.

A three-bay shop at that pace is processing a meaningful amount of work every day. If software helps the front desk save time, speed approvals, and avoid a dealer referral on even a few jobs, the benefit compounds across the month. The question is not whether the system looks modern, it's whether each bay produces more usable revenue.

Run the math the way a lender would

A reasonable ROI model starts with admin time. If a platform saves 10+ hours per week on office work, that is time that can go back into estimates, calls, follow-up, and closing work. Price the real cost, not just the monthly fee

True cost includes setup, onboarding, payment processing, customization, and contract flexibility. A cheap tool with painful integrations is not cheap for long. A platform with transparent pricing and month-to-month terms is easier to justify because the owner can leave if it stops performing.

Customization matters too. Shops don't all run the same way, and software that forces every counter person into the same script usually creates workarounds. A system has to fit how the team already moves cars, or adoption stalls.

Your 90-Day Implementation Roadmap

The worst software rollout is the one that tries to fix everything on day one. Shops do better with a clean sequence, one workflow at a time, one team habit at a time. That lowers drama and keeps the bay moving while the office learns the new system.

A 90-day implementation roadmap for auto shops featuring three phases: foundation, core integration, and optimization.

Days 1 to 30, build the foundation

Start with data import, cleanup, and team access. Then train the staff on the Digital Shop Board and switch one workflow end to end, usually digital inspections. The point is to get one clean process working before the rest of the stack goes live.

Dirty customer data causes more pain than bad software. Missing phone numbers, duplicate records, and old vehicle histories will poison confidence quickly. Advisors need buy-in too, because if the front desk resists the new flow, technicians end up doing the old work anyway.

Days 31 to 60, connect the money flow

Turn on parts ordering, online payments, and branded website updates. Then train service advisors on the customer-facing side so they can explain approvals and payment options without sounding like they're reading from a manual.

Keep tech training at the bay when possible. Pulling technicians away for long classroom sessions kills momentum and makes the system feel like an interruption. It works better when the workflow is learned on real cars, not in a conference room.

Days 61 to 90, tighten the operation

Turn on analytics, refine AI prompts, and standardize shop-floor procedures so the system supports compliance-minded work habits.
